Clovis Tristao wrote:
Hi,
My installation of the ClamAV does not have clamd.conf in /etc, as
makes to install it?
I installed in Fedora Core 4 distro.
Since already I am thankful,
clamd.conf is configuration file for clamav daemon, you should
install package clamav-server too.
